MEET ELLIS RASKIN:

Ellis Raskin is a trusted environmental attorney and community advocate. He advises public agencies and other stakeholders throughout California about urban development, housing laws, and environmental policy. He has been a leading proponent of city programs that promote sustainability, address homelessness, and protect renters who are at risk of eviction and displacement.

Following his appointment to the Santa Monica Urban Forest Task Force in 2017, Ellis was elevated to the Santa Monica Planning Commission in 2020. Ellis has never been afraid to cast a dissenting vote.

Ellis is a graduate of Occidental College and the University of California, Hastings College of the Law. Outside of work and public service, Ellis often spends his time exploring Santa Monica and enjoying walks beneath the city’s spectacular urban forest.
